India, March 21 -- How did you conceptualise the film, Sir?
The questions the film asks have been with me for almost my entire life. I was aware of class divisions as a child... While growing up, many of us need caretakers and we are close to them but there is always a barrier when it comes to love.
As an adult, I employed women in my home, women who I grew close to... There is tremendous intimacy when one shares a home, though of course it is a bit one-sided. For instance, someone who works for you can read your moods, they know if you've had a bad day, or if you don't eat well, or if a phone call suddenly changes your demeanour. Perhaps, even though we do not read them carefully but a bond that develops over time.
